II Services on the Trunk Route

(i) Both sides hope that the traffic on the London-Kuala

Lumpur route can be so developed that a daily frequency can be

operated by the national flag carriers of each country by the mid-

1980s.

(ii) British Airways (BA) and Malaysian Airline System (MAS) may

operate wide bodied aircraft between London and Kuala Lumpur in each

direction on UK and Malaysian Routes 1 respectively.
